Message type: E = Error
Message class: CBGLWI - Labeling Workbench Messages
Message number: 021
Message text: &1 print requests ready for printing
&V1& print requests were transferred to background processing and can
therefore be printed. The status of the print requests has been updated.
The system issues an error message and will not allow you to continue with this transaction until the error is resolved.
For information about the print requests, go to the <LS>Log</> tab page
of the <LS>detail view</> in the labeling workbench.
If you want to check the updated status of the print requests, execute
the query again on the <LS>Print Requests</> tab page in the labeling
workbench.

- &1 print requests ready for printing ?The SAP error message CBGLWI021 indicates that there are print requests that are ready for printing but have not yet been processed. This message typically arises in the context of SAP's output management system, where documents or reports are queued for printing but may not be printed due to various reasons.
Cause:
- Print Queue Issues: The print requests may be stuck in the print queue due to printer configuration issues or network problems.
- Printer Status: The printer may be offline, out of paper, or experiencing hardware malfunctions.
- Output Device Configuration: The output device may not be correctly configured in SAP.
-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to process the print requests.
- Job Scheduling: The print jobs may not be scheduled correctly or may be waiting for a specific condition to be met.
Solution:
- Check Printer Status: Verify that the printer is online and functioning properly. Check for any error messages on the printer itself.
- Review Print Queue: Use transaction code SP01 to check the status of the print jobs. Look for any jobs that are stuck or have errors.
- Output Device Configuration: Ensure that the output device is correctly configured in SAP. You can check this using transaction code SPAD (Spool Administration).
- Reprocess Print Requests: If the print requests are stuck, you can try to reprocess them. This can be done by selecting the jobs in SP01 and choosing the option to reprint or release them.
- Check Authorizations: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to access and manage print requests.
- Check Job Scheduling: If the print jobs are scheduled, ensure that they are set to run at the correct time and that there are no dependencies preventing them from being processed.
